Board OKs MOUs with Glenn County Office of Education for driver training and schoolwide mental‑health services

Stony Creek Joint Unified School District Board of Education · November 10, 2025

The board approved two memoranda of understanding with the Glenn County Office of Education—one to provide bus driver training and one for schoolwide mental‑health services—each passed 3–0 with one trustee absent.

The Stony Creek Joint Unified School District board approved two memoranda of understanding with the Glenn County Office of Education. One MOU covers bus driver training for the district; the other provides schoolwide mental‑health services. Both motions were moved by Trustee Diana Corkill, seconded by Trustee Cathie Bodeker, and carried by a 3–0 vote (one trustee absent, one seat vacant).

Board minutes record the approvals as routine items under new business; the meeting did not include detailed program budgets, staffing plans or timelines for the mental‑health services MOU beyond the approval motion. The approvals mean the district will coordinate with the county office on driver certification/training and on expanded mental‑health supports reported in the MOU text.
